Tengo tendencia a mirar las imágenes antes de leer el texto. J’ai tendance à regarder les images avant de lire le texte.
La vista de la Tierra desde la Luna es una de las imágenes icónicas del siglo XX. La vue de la Terre depuis la Lune est une des images emblématiques du XXe siècle.
¿Qué imaginas cuando miras esa imagen? Qu'imagines-tu quand tu regardes cette image ?
Ella recortó una imagen del libro. Elle découpa une image du livre.
La imagen se ve mejor de lejos. Cette image rend mieux de loin.
Dios creó al hombre a su imagen. Dieu créa l'homme à son image.
Si tú quieres ser electo, deberás mejorar tu imagen. Si tu veux être élu, tu vas devoir soigner ton image.
Observa la imagen en la parte superior de la página. Regarde l'image en haut de la page.
La imagen que se proyecta en la retina está invertida. L'image projetée dans la rétine est inversée.
La chica de esta imagen lleva una corona, no de oro, sino de flores. La fille sur cette image porte une couronne non pas d'or mais de fleurs.
